Tell me if you'd list these SEO factors in different order of importance.

Here are the SEO factors in order of importance with the first one on the list being most important and the last one on the least being the least important.

Factor #1
First you need to have your target key phrase on your page before you have a chance to rank for the word. Have it on your title tag and the body of the copy. There used to be a time where if a number of sites linked to you with an irrelevant key phrase, which didn't exist on your page, you could rank high for that term but now, you must have that word on your page.

Factor #2
Inbound links pointing to your web page (or document) with your target key phrase.

Factor #3
Factor #1 was to fist have the word on the page. Factor #3 is about having your keyword in strategic places on the page like the title tag, H tags, etc.

Factor #4
Internal links on your own site pointing to page have key phrase in anchor text. That includs breadcrumbs and navigational links (if possible)

Factor #5

key phrase in the name of the web page or document. Basically in the url slug.

Would you add these factors in a different order?

    Here let me give it a try...

    On-page factors...

    1. Main keyword phrase in your <TITLE> tag
    2. keyword in description
    3. keyword in url
    4. keyword in <H1> tag
    5. keyword in 1st sentence of content
    6. keyword in last sentence
    7. link to internal page using keyword as anchor text
    8. outbound link to authority page (wikipedia, google, whatever) using keyword as anhcor, and add the 'nofollow' attribute to the anchor tag.
    9. keyword in image tag (alt attribute)

    Off-page

    1. link to page using keyword as anchor text
    2. link to page using a keyword from the Google wonderwheel
    3. link to the page using the URL itself

    And for Pete's sake... backlink to other internal pages... don't just slam your homepage with links and leave the other pages with no links.

    This is what works for me anyway... everyone has their own "checklist" of things they use.
